Kudos to Dell Tech Support

The cooling fan on my daughter's 3000 started doing the jet engine thing some time ago, but she didn't really bug me about it until last week (well, actually my wife started bugging me).
 
I e-mailed tech support on Tuesday evening, got the automated response Wednesday, to which I replied immediately (I had already narrowed it down). Later that evening, they e-mailed me that they would send someone out. The guy called Thursday, came out Friday evening and replaced the fan in about five minutes.
